The paper covers tectonic processes and hazards, glaciated landscapes and change, coastal landscapes and change, fieldwork skills, geographical enquiry techniques, and synoptic evaluation tasks using real-world geographical scenarios and resource materials.
Section A focuses on tectonic processes and hazards, including plate movement, plate tectonic theory, multiple hazard zones, vulnerability using the Pressure and Release (PAR) model, and comparative impacts of earthquakes and volcanic eruptions. Section B examines glaciated landscapes and change with questions on glacier retreat in the Himalayas, proglacial landforms, glacial management strategies, Isle of Arran fieldwork preparation, and an extended evaluation of tectonic and glacial opportunities and challenges in Sangay National Park, Ecuador. Section C explores coastal landscapes and change through coastal retreat data, shoreline management policies, flood risk factors, coastal recession, Seaford sediment-cell fieldwork, and an evaluative synoptic investigation into tectonic and coastal opportunities and challenges in the Galápagos Islands.
The paper includes official resource-booklet figures, maps, annotated fieldwork materials, statistical interpretation tasks, geographical calculations, and high-level evaluative essay questions that test analytical, fieldwork, and decision-making skills under timed examination conditions.
